Official abstract text for this publication.
Method and network entities for providing good performance for voice in multiRAB connection for services of a CS+PS call setup ( 31 ) without high throughput necessity but providing good throughput for the services needing it. A differentiation of the multiRAB configuration (bearer type, mobility parameters and channel switching timers), based on service detection, is performed either in the RAN either in the CN indicating eventually this detection to the RAN. If the detected service needs high bit rate/throughput ( 35 ), the RNC reconfigures the multiRAB configuration ( 37 ) so that a bearer type providing high throughput is allocated to said service and the RNC reassigns mobility and channel switching parameters to maximise this throughput and the radio resources. If the service does not require high throughput ( 34 ), the RNC configures a bearer type and parameters for mobility and channel switching as specified by the standards to provide good performance ( 36 ), low dropped call rate.
